Launched: BMW XM – 653 HP PHEV Super-SUV Lands, Priced From RM1.3 Million+

BMW Group Malaysia sees its local line-up expanded once again as it introduces the groundbreaking new BMW XM model today. The first independently-built M model since the M1 from 1978 comes in the form of an electrified plug-in hybrid (PHEV) super-SUV – or ‘Sports Activity Vehicle’ (SAV), as how BMW terms all its X-series crossover SUVs.


As far as styling goes, the XM will divide opinions to say the least, more so given its overall size, bulk, and the massive signature kidney grilles it packs up front. Other key styling cues present include massive 23-inch allow wheels, distinct all-LED head- and taillight designs, and the striking ‘Night Gold Line’ exterior trim option that adds prominent gold-hued contrasting accents on top of gloss-black ones.

Up to seven exterior paint options are available. Included amongst them are Cape York Green, Carbon Black, Marina Bay Blue, Toronto Red, Mineral White, Black Sapphire and Dravit Grey. Also, besides the ‘Night Gold Line’ trim mentioned, there also a darker and more subtle ‘Shadow Line’ exterior trimline option available.


The XM stands as the first BMW model to harness the M  Hybrid drive system, which employs a 4.4-litre twin-turbo V8 petrol mill and an integrated electric motor plus a 25.7 kWh battery pack. Combined, the setup delivers a whopping 653 HP and 800 NM to drive all four wheels via an 8-speed M Steptronic transmission and M xDrive all-wheel-drive (AWD) suite, allowing the super-SUV to despatch 0-100 KM/H in just 4.3 seconds and hit a claimed V-max of 270 KM/H.

Crucially, electrification sees this super-SUV offer frugal fuel consumption between 1.5 – 1.6 litres/100 KM on average, as well as low CO2 emissions averaging between 33 – 36 g/KM too. Additionally, the electrified system also boasts up to 88 KM of all-electric driving range. As for battery charging input and time, the XM accepts AC charging inputs of up to 7.4 kW, promising a full charge (0-100%) in 4 hours and 15 minutes.


Matching its high-speed performance is the promise of unrivalled agility thanks to the adoption of the Adaptive M Suspension Professional suite. This laces the XM’s chassis with electronically controlled dampers plus Active Roll Stabilisation to reduce lateral body movements. Supplementing that is the inclusion of an M Sport Differential which variably distributes the driving power between the rear wheels, thus improving traction and driving stability.

Besides that, the XM also gets an Integral Active Steering system. This works by turning the rear wheels in tandem with the front wheel at high speeds for greater vehicle stability. At lower speeds, the rear wheels instead steer in the opposite direction of the front wheels to improve manoeuvrability. Also present are massive 508 MM compound front disc brakes grabbed by bespoke M Sport brake calipers finished in gloss black.


On board, the XM is laced with a bevy of advanced tech and amenities, key amongst which being the latest BMW Live Cockpit Professional suite that features both a 12.3-inch digital instrument panel and a 14.9-inch central touchscreen display plus a head-up display (HUD) module, the former duo also running off the latest M specific BMW Operating System 8 as well.

Other noteworthy features present here include the BMW Intelligent Personal Assistant voice command suite, BMW ID personalised settings, novel BMW Gesture Control function, the Connected Package Professional I, Intelligent Emergency Call, Teleservices, Connected Drive Services, both Apple CarPlay and Android Auto connectivity, as well as the Comfort Access and BMW Digital Key Plus keyless entry suites.


On the driving assist front, the BMW XM is also fully-loaded with a bevy of active and semi-autonomous Driving Assistant Professional features. Highlights here include Steering and Lane Control Assistant, Automatic Speed Limit Assist, Lane Change Assistant, Active Cruise Control with Stop&Go, Lane Departure Warning, Front/Rear Crossing Traffic Warning, as well as Emergency Stop Assistant and Evasion Assistant.

These, by the way come on top of Parking Assistant Plus including Reversing Assist, Lateral Parking Aid, Active Park Distance Control, and Surround View system, as well as other advanced safety features such as Attentiveness Assistant, Acoustic Protection for Pedestrians, and Active Protection.


Advanced tech aside, a bevy of interior trim options are available too. The choices here include Leather Merino Deep Lagoon with exclusive contents, Leather Merino Silverstone with exclusive contents, Leather Merino Black and Leather Merino Sakhir Orange.

BMW Malaysia had already opened the order books for the XM back in Oct 2022 before confirming its prices back in January this year. With today’s official launch, figures from the latter remains unchanged, reading at a whopping RM1,316,450, or RM1,398,800 with the optional Extended Warranty & Service Package included (both excluding insurance costs).
